Green Tech and Adequate Energy Use Are the Future of iGaming

Online casino entertainment has long been associated with high adaptability, massive servers, and 24/7 data centre operation. Behind this comfort stand high power usage, pressure on infrastructure, and an increase in the carbon footprint.

To lessen their negative impact on the environment, providers are often implementing ESG initiatives. Such practices are becoming part of entrepreneurs’ long-term strategies, impacting the profitability of gambling platforms and their attractiveness to investors.

The Impact of the iGaming Sector on the Environment

According to Gitnux Market Data:

  • 1% of the world’s electricity use is accounted for by information centres serving entertainment and streaming portals;
  • the gambling industry generates 0.5% of the global carbon footprint.

These figures are not yet comparable to the emissions of such powerhouses as mining, air travel, or metallurgy. However, they are already significant enough to attract public attention.

At the end-user level, the environmental impact is also much felt. For example, the average gaming PC consumes 300–600 watts, while a server that supports live entertainment or betting content consumes several times more.

Ecological Footprint in Online Gambling

Let us consider the sources of impact on the global environment and methods of minimising them.

Data Centres and Server Clusters

This is the foundation of any infrastructure in charge for the smooth operation of online casinos, betting sites, and live streaming platforms. These facilities work 24/7, supporting millions of entertainment sessions and real-time transactions.

According to the Uptime Institute, 40% of data centre capacity is spent on cooling the equipment. Therefore, even with the implementation of advanced technologies like those based on the outside air, the costs of information clusters remain enormous.

A single facility of this kind consumes 100–200 MW of energy per year. Major operators (Bet365, Flutter, DraftKings, and Evolution) use dozens of server locations all over the world.

Transitioning to “green” data centres is a key method of reducing consumption. They are powered by solar, wind, and hydroelectric power plants.

By 2030, many leading companies plan to achieve a zero-carbon footprint for their processing servers. Playtech, Kindred Group, and other market participants have also said about it.

Streaming Platforms

According to the Cisco Annual Internet Report, 80% of global Internet traffic is video. Game streaming and live broadcasts account for a growing share of this volume. One hour of 4K transmission consumes 7 GB of data, which, when scaled to millions of users, turns into hundreds of petabytes of compartmentalised information.

To reduce the load, providers implement the following elements:

  • dynamic stream adaptation (switch between 720p, 1080p, and 4K resolution depending on the connection speed);
  • edge computing, where some of the calculations are performed closer to the player;
  • efficient audio codecs (for example, AV1), which reduce the bitrate without losing image quality.

Game Client

According to a study by Fraunhofer IZM, the average casino visitor consumes 50–60 kW of energy per month — almost as much as a washing machine over the same period.

The longer and more frequently a customer is online, the higher the overall carbon footprint of the gambling ecosystem.

Developers strive to reduce resource consumption without compromising the quality of the UX or user experience.

Effective optimisation methods include:

  • implementation of modern shaders (programs for video processing);
  • frame-rate control (FPS) in live dealer content;
  • improved transmitted data compression.

Physical Infrastructure

iGaming platforms cannot operate without:

  • offices;
  • support centres;
  • live dealer studios;
  • land-based casinos.

All of these facilities require constant lighting, heating, ventilation, and AC. It significantly contributes to the companies' total energy consumption.

For example, Evolution and Pragmatic Play live studios use dozens of video cameras, screens, lighting devices, and network equipment. Consequently, they consume megawatts of electricity daily.

In 2025, many companies were planning to open “smart offices”. These spaces are equipped with LEDs, automatic temperature, energy control systems, and solar panels.

It is possible to offset emissions of land-based locations with the help of carbon credits and tree planting.

Equipment and E-Waste

According to the UN, more than 50 million tons of it are generated worldwide annually, but only 17% of this is recycled properly. The IT sector, including the iGaming segment, makes a significant contribution to this indicator.

One of the trends in recent years is the implementation of Hardware Recycling programs. Their essence lies in returning old equipment to manufacturers, reusing components, and recycling rare earth metals.

The modular server market is also actively developing. The replacement of just a few individual blocks in a cluster can reduce e-waste by 20–30%.

Energy Profile of Gaming Brands

Energy profile of gambling platforms: power consumption

This is the set of all processes that consume energy and generate a carbon footprint. The technical document shows how electricity, heat, and resources go out as part of the provider's work.

Basic profile details are:

  1. Power consumption (kWh). The capacity required to manage servers, GPU clusters, data storage systems, and network equipment.
  2. Cooling and ventilation. Costs borne by the enterprise to maintain a stable temperature and humidity in server rooms, backup systems, and heat recovery units.
  3. The use of green energy. The share of electricity supplied from renewable sources.
  4. CO2 emissions. There are direct emissions of companies (Scope 1), indirect pollution (Scope 2), and hidden contamination (Scope 3).
  5. Electronic waste. The amount of equipment that must be replaced, recycled, or disposed of.

Leading gambling brands such as Kindred Group, Entain, Playtech, and Bet365 are now openly sharing their data.

The public placement of details is an excellent image step. Partners, investors, and players see that the firm cares about environmental issues and is taking real actions to reduce its impact on the ecology.

The availability of confirmed information helps entrepreneurs comply with the following regulatory requirements:

  1. In the EU and the UK, vendors with a certain total income are required to notify of CO2 emissions, power usage, and sustainable initiatives.
  2. In the US, similar requirements are being discussed at the state level, particularly for enterprises with proprietary data centres.

Companies that have energy indicators and systematically monitor them can reduce bills by 10–25%. They switch to efficient solutions and optimise the server’s work during peak hours.

Green Render in the iGaming Niche

This is another approach that has been actively used in the entertainment industry in recent years. Its essence lies in the reduction of the load on processors and video cards (CPUs and GPUs) without degrading image quality and stability of sessions.

A green render helps make visuals less energy-intensive. The convenience and dynamism of the gameplay are fully preserved, which is especially important for live casinos, eSports betting sites, and streaming platforms.

Key optimisation technologies:

  1. Dynamic adjustment of the graphics quality. The system automatically makes images less clear when the user is idle, viewing the results of rounds, or viewing menus. This saves resources without worsening the visual experience.
  2. Hardware acceleration. Modern GPU programs and specialised video chips can independently process content. The application of such solutions relieves the CPU and reduces power consumption.
  3. Network load optimisation. CDN servers distribute products closer to customers, allowing Internet traffic to go on a shorter route. This makes delays and data retransmissions rarer.
  4. Coding streams. The transition to modern video broadcast formats and adaptive bitrates also helps cut down consumption indicators.
  5. Power-saving server modes. When the activity of gamblers decreases (for example, at night), the equipment can enter a partial sleep state. During this time, the fan speed is reduced, and the cooling systems operate in economy mode.
  6. Infrastructure upgrade. Top companies are already implementing AI systems. These programs manage equipment temperature and load in real time, significantly decreasing consumption and emissions.

A green render helps reduce energy expenditure by 8–10%, which is especially noticeable during long live sessions and streams. For large enterprises, savings reach millions of kilowatt-hours per year. This leads to reduced carbon pollution and operating costs.

Energy Profiles and Green Renders: Benefits for Casino Owners

In 2025, ESG standards will have become an integral part of the image and reporting of many international firms, including iGaming brands.

When providers demonstrate reduced CO2 emissions and a transition to renewable energy sources, they gain:

  • access to green investments and grants;
  • trust of players and partners;
  • licensing advantages in Europe, the US, and Asia.

For example, in 2024, Betsson Group announced that 100% of the energy for its European data centres would come from renewable sources. This statement, backed by current statistics, became a powerful marketing ploy and allowed entrepreneurs to attract investments, as well as enter new markets.
